This NASA report describes a renewed strategic outlook to provide essential space environment knowledge for the benefit of society and for space exploration. It communicates our progress made to date, our plans for the future, and our opportunities for supporting the Agency's vision and mission. The field of Space Physics has made rapid and spectacular advances over the past few years. Utilization of combinations of missions, each one with its own complement of instruments, has been vital to the emergence of a new view of the Sun and Solar System as a connected system. There will be further dramatic advances as observational techniques, new missions, and a new understanding of how microphysical processes influence broad-scale dynamics emerge in the not-too-distant future. Each discovery impels us to ask new questions or regard old ones in new ways. How and why does the Sun vary? How do planetary systems respond? What are the impacts on humanity? This roadmap outlines a common groundwork of inquiry spanning all the space physics branches of learning. It is anticipated that this will lead to a unification of long-separated fields of inquiry; thereby enabling the emergence of new and significant scientific insights. Heliophysics is the comprehensive new term for the science of the Sun-Solar System Connection; exploration, discovery, and understanding of our space environment; system science that unites all of the linked phenomena in the region of the cosmos influenced by a star like our Sun. Heliophysics concentrates on the Sun and its effects on Earth, the other planets of the solar system, and the changing conditions in space. Heliophysics studies the magnetosphere, ionosphere, thermosphere, mesosphere, and upper atmosphere of the Earth and other planets. Heliophysics combines the science of the Sun, corona, heliosphere and geospace.
Heliophysics encompasses cosmic rays and particle acceleration, space weather and radiation, dust and magnetic reconnection, solar activity and stellar cycles, aeronomy and space plasmas, magnetic fields and global change, and the interactions of the solar system with our galaxy.
